The contamination from Asse is minimal and at depths like -900 m that are never reaching any surface waters. Asse stores low- and medium-activity waste. For example, the largest leak found was 240 kBq/l which is roughly natural (!) radioactivity of a group of 60 people (from K-40 isotope).
